construct dwelling house together with all ancillary siteworks

Refused

Core Refusal Reason

The applicant failed to demonstrate a genuine rural housing need in accordance with Objective RHO 1 of the Mayo County Development Plan 2022-2028 for a site zoned as Agriculture.

Decision Maker's Conclusion

  • The applicant did not demonstrate a genuine rural housing need as defined by Objective RHO 1, specifically because the applicant's existing family home is located within the Castlebar town boundary on land zoned for residential use rather than in a rural area.
  • The proposed development on land zoned for agriculture would constitute haphazard development that militates against the preservation of the rural environment and interferes with the character of the landscape.
  • Granting permission would lead to the uneconomic provision of public services and communal facilities and would be contrary to the proper planning and sustainable development of the area.

Cited Policies (CDP)

Objective RHO 1Mayo County Development Plan 2022-2028Castlebar Town and Environs Local Area Plan 2023-2029

Decision Document Summary

Melissa Brinklow sought permission to construct a single-storey dwelling with a basement and ancillary works on a 0.212ha site at Snugborough, Rathbaun, Castlebar. The site is located on land zoned for Agriculture under the Castlebar Town and Environs Local Area Plan 2023-2029.
